On August 4, 2026, Udhayanidhi Stalin, Tamil Nadu Leader of the Opposition and DMK youth wing leader, was arrested in Chennai for allegedly making misogynist remarks at a Thanjavur public meeting. He was taken to Sengipatti police station for questioning but released on station bail by Madras High Court order after nearly 90 minutes.
